LINUX
Effective January 1, 2004, Red Hat will be discontinuing maintenance
for the 7.1, 7.2, 7.3, and 8.0 versions of their Red Hat Linux product
offerings. In order to stay current with the direction of this operating
system vendor and to continue providing state-of-the-art software
for your Red Hat Linux platform, Group 1 Software has found it necessary
to increase the minimum supported level of Red Hat Linux for all
our products to Enterprise Linux version 2.1. All currently released
Group 1 products will run on Enterprise Linux version 2.1 after
upgrading your operating system. There is no need to reinstall your
products.
If you are currently operating on any version of Red Hat Linux
below Enterprise Linux 2.1, please make plans to transition to this
new version before January 1, 2004, in order to continue receiving
technical support from Group 1.
Mainframe - MVS
Group 1 Software has added support for the z/OS.e operating system.
If you are a current MVS customer and are considering implementing
z/OS.e in your production environment, your current Group 1 MVS
Language Environment compliant software can be run in batch mode
only on the z/OS.e operating system with a few modifications to
your production JCL. If you are currently running a Group 1 legacy
product written in assembler, this product will install and execute
under z/OS.e without modification.
For detailed instructions on JCL modifications as well as instructions on how
to implement G1LEINIT on your z/OS.e system, please review the additional information
included with the download. If you would like this download, please go to the
Group 1 Web site, http://www.g1.com, login to Support, Special Request Downloads,
and enter the Access Code: G1LEINIT. This download includes an assembler
application (G1LEINIT) that will execute Group 1 COBOL applications via the
Language Environment CEEPIPI pre-initialization interface in order to run your
Group 1 product(s) on the z/OS.e operating system.
